Mail sunucularda her sistem yöneticisinin en büyük belalısı spam mailler yani istenmeyen maillerdir. Ne kadar önlem alırsak alalım bir şekilde spam mailler, mail kullanıcılarına ulaşıyor. Spam yapan kişiler sürekli taktik değiştirip, mail kullanıcılarına ulaşmayı başarıyor. Biz de gerekli önlemleri almaya çalışıyoruz.
Postfix, linux ve unix işletim sistemleri üzerinde çalışabilen, açık kaynaklı bir MTA (mail transfer agent) servisi. Kısaca, Linux veya Unix sunucularımız üzerinden mail göndermeye yarayan bir mail sunucusudur. Özellikle Plesk kontrol paneli üzerinde linux hosting kullanıcıları tarafından da kullanılıyor. Plesk web hosting kontrol panelini Linux üzerinde kullanıyorsanız, qmail ve postfix olarak iki MTA’dan birini seçmeniz gerekiyor.
Plesk üzerinde mail ayarlarında spam ile mücadele için bir çok seçenek bulunuyor. Sadece ayarlar değil, Plesk’in ve farklı geliştiricilerin yazdığı bir kaç tane anti spam çözümü sunuluyor. Genellikle ücretli olarak sunulan bu anti spamlara ücret vermek istemiyor ve dışarıdan da anti spam gw hizmeti almıyorsanız, spam için ayarlarınızı kendinizin yapılandırması gerekecektir.
Plesk Windows veya Linux kullanıyorsanız, spam ile mücadelede RBL (realtime blocking list) oldukça iyi engelleme yapıyor. RBL kullanımını için Plesk RBL ile Spamla Mücadele yazımızı okuyabilirsiniz. Plesk mail sunucu ayarları için ise bu yazımıza göz gezdirebilirsiniz.
Plesk üzerinde veya diğer paneller ile Postfix kullanıyorsanız veya direkt olarak panelsiz Postfix kullanımı gerçekleştiriyorsanız, yapılandırma dosyalarındaki ayarlar ile belirli domain uzantılarını basit şekilde engelleyebilirsiniz.
Özellikle .xyz, .icu, .stream gibi diğerlerine göre nispeten daha ucuz satılan domain uzantıları üzerinden bir çok fazla spam mail gönderimi yapılıyor. .xyz domain uzantısı da genellikle, ciddi çalışan firmalar tarafından kullanılmıyor. Eğer .xyz gibi domain uzantılarından mail alışverişi yapmıyorsanız, kurumsal hosting çözümleri sunuyorsanız bu domain uzantısını engeleyebilirsiniz.
Öncelikle Postfix kurulu sunucumuza root kullanıcısı ile veya root yetkisine haiz kullanıcımız ile ulaşalım. Daha sonra engellemek istediğimiz domain uzantılarını içeren, Postfix’in istediği şekilde bir dosya yaratalım;
nano /etc/postfix/reject_domains
Not : Postfix’in olduğu dizin Linux dağıtımına göre veya Unix işletim sisteminde iseniz değişebilir. Örneğin Freebsd üzerinde /usr/local/etc/postfix/ dizininde bulunur.
Daha sonra reject_domains dosyamızın içine engellemek istediğimiz domain uzantılarını yazalım;
/\.pro$/ REJECT
/\.top$/ REJECT
/\.zip$/ REJECT
/\.xyz$/ REJECT
/\.stream$/ REJECT
Dosyayı ctrl+x ile kaydedip çıkalım. Siz belirlediğiniz farklı domain uzantısı var ise onları da yazabilirsiniz.
Daha sonra Postfix yapılandırma dosyasını açalım;
/etc/postfix/main.cf
ve aşağıdaki satırı ekleyelim;
smtpd_sender_restrictions = check_sender_access pcre:/etc/postfix/reject_domains
Postfix yapılandırmasını yeniden yükleyelim;
postfix reload
Eğer herhangi bir hata almadıysanız artık yukarıdaki domain uzantıları engellenecek, mail sunucunuza mail gönderemeyecektir.
Postfix ile domain uzantısı nasıl engellenir?
Öncelikle reject_domains
adında bir dosya oluşturulur ve içerisine engellenmek istenen uzantılar regex ile tanımlanır (örneğin /\.xyz$/ REJECT
). Bu dosya main.cf
dosyasına check_sender_access
ile bağlanarak postfix servisi reload edilir.
Plesk kullanıyorum, spam filtrelemeyi nasıl özelleştirebilirim?
Plesk paneli üzerinde RBL listeleri, DKIM/SPF kayıtları, greylisting ve antivirüs eklentileri ile spam filtreleme yapılabilir. Ek olarak, Postfix’i özelleştirerek belirli domain uzantılarına veya gönderen IP’lerine filtre uygulanabilir.
.xyz ve .top gibi domainleri engellemek SEO açısından zararlı mı?
Hayır, eğer bu uzantılardan iş yapan güvenilir bir ileti ortağınız yoksa ve bu uzantılar üzerinden spam alıyorsanız, bunları engellemek sunucu güvenliği açısından faydalıdır.
Postfix filtreleri neden düzenli olarak güncellenmelidir?
Spam göndericiler sürekli yeni yöntemler denediği için, filtre listelerinizin (özellikle RBL ve domain uzantısı filtrelerinin) güncel tutulması, spamla etkili mücadele açısından önemlidir.
Plesk üzerinden Postfix yapılandırması yapılabilir mi?
Evet, Plesk paneli üzerinden postfix temel ayarları değiştirilebilir. Ancak detaylı özelleştirmeler ve regex tabanlı filtreler için SSH erişimi ile yapılandırma dosyalarının düzenlenmesi gerekir.
Postfix yapılandırması yanlış olursa ne olur?
Yanlış yapılandırmalar, e-posta gönderim ve alım işlemlerini bozabilir. Bu yüzden her yapılandırmadan sonra postfix check
komutu ile doğrulama yapılmalı ve postfix reload
ile dikkatli şekilde uygulanmalıdır.
Fidye Yazılımı Saldırısı Nedir? Fidye yazılımı saldırısı (ransomware) kötü niyetli kişilerin, belirli bir sistemin, dosyalarını…
Plesk, dünya genelinde en yaygın kullanılan web hosting kontrol panellerinden biridir. Gerek Linux gerekse Windows…
Bilgi teknolojilerinde, sunucular ve network cihazları her zaman en önemli araçlar arasındadır. Özellikle veri merkezleri…
SSL NEDİR? SSL sertifikasının ne olduğu hakkında fikriniz olmayabilir ya da birileri web sayfanızın SSL sertifikasına…
Dünya genelinde en çok kullanılan hosting kontrol paneli Plesk Panel’de e-posta oluşturmak için gerekli adımları…
Outlook iş dünyası ve bireysel hayatımız dahil olmak üzere çok yaygın bir kullanıma sahip olan,…
View Comments
Teşekkürler sayenizden xyz domainlerden kurtuldum.